What is the correct way of building up pressure in the wings on these drills? New to us 6m st has recently arrived but the pressure guage seems stuck on zero. Folding the wings down and keeping the hydraulics pressurized doesn't seem to do anything.

Sounds like you’re doing it the right way. Maybe the gauge is blown?
 
Sounds like you’re doing it the right way. Maybe the gauge is blown?
All sorted now thanks. Guage is ok, just seems to take quite a long while after unfolding for the pressure to rise. Folded wings back up a few inches then re pressurizing them seems to do the trick. Had a go at some drilling but a bit too sticky on the rear tyres.
